FILE’s Technical Reality Check
FILE is painting a textbook accumulation pattern at $0.94, sitting comfortably above all short-term moving averages while the RSI at 54.51 signals neither overbought euphoria nor oversold capitulation. The MACD histogram has flattened to zero, indicating momentum is coiling for the next directional move. With price trading at 0.63 position within the Bollinger Bands, FILE has room to run toward the upper band at $0.99 without triggering immediate selling pressure.
The daily ATR of $0.04 shows volatility has compressed significantly, typically preceding explosive moves in either direction. Price action is respecting the $0.92 immediate support level while eyeing the $0.96 resistance that’s been capping rallies.
Volume & Price Alignment
The derivatives market is telling a compelling story that contradicts the sideways price action. Top traders are positioned 57.8% long versus retail’s more balanced 52.2% long ratio, suggesting institutional accumulation is happening beneath the surface. This 1.37 smart money ratio typically precedes significant upward moves when combined with the current 1.11 taker buy/sell ratio showing aggressive buying pressure.
Open interest has grown marginally by 0.26% to $36.2 million, indicating fresh money is entering positions rather than existing traders adding size. The neutral funding rate at 0.0076% means there’s no excessive leverage premium, keeping the setup clean for a sustained move.
